我有一个AngularJS应用程序,我正在研究usemin任务.这个应用程序有2个html页面,都包括一个缩小为common.js的块,其他页面包括为这些特定页面缩小的js.
page1.html
<!-- build:js scripts/common.js -->
<!-- bower:js -->
<script src="a.js"></script>
<script src="b.js"></script>
<!-- endbower -->
<!-- endbuild -->
<!-- build:js scripts/page1.js -->
<!-- bower:js -->
<script src="c.js"></script>
<script src="d.js"></script>
<!-- endbower -->
<!-- endbuild -->
Run Code Online (Sandbox Code Playgroud)
page2.html
<!-- build:js scripts/common.js -->
<!-- bower:js -->
<script src="a.js"></script>
<script src="b.js"></script>
<!-- endbower -->
<!-- endbuild -->
<!-- build:js scripts/page2.js -->
<!-- bower:js -->
<script src="e.js"></script>
<script src="f.js"></script>
<!-- endbower -->
<!-- endbuild -->
Run Code Online (Sandbox Code Playgroud)
Gruntfile.js
useminPrepare: {
    html: ['<%= yeoman.app %>/page1.html', '<%= yeoman.app …Run Code Online (Sandbox Code Playgroud) 我在Edge 20.10240.16384.0上测试了这个
我有一个元素,其位置是固定的,并应用了CSS过滤器.这适用于除Microsoft Edge之外的所有浏览器,其中元素的位置不会保持固定.此问题与CSS3过滤器直接相关,因为删除它们会使位置修复正常
这是一个基本的例子.它在Microsoft Edge以外的浏览器上正常工作(也就是固定背景保持固定).
<!DOCTYPE html>
<html>
<head>
  <style>
    body {
      height: 5000px;
    }
    
    .fixed {
      position: fixed;
      left: 0;
      background-image: url(https://lh5.googleusercontent.com/-REJ8pezTyCQ/SDlvLzhAH-I/AAAAAAAABeQ/mC1PXNiheJU/s800/Blog_background_750.gif);
      background-repeat: repeat;
      background-attachment: fixed;
      height: 100%;
      width: 100%;
      -webkit-filter: brightness(70%);
      -moz-filter: brightness(70%);
      -o-filter: brightness(70%);
      filter: brightness(70%);
    }
  </style>
</head>
<body>
  <div class='fixed'></div>
</body>
</html>Run Code Online (Sandbox Code Playgroud)
在搜索之后,我遇到了https://connect.microsoft.com/IE/feedback/details/1810480/ms-edge-rendering-problem-of-css-filter,它详细说明了同样的问题,但已被标记为已修复最有可能因为它无法复制.我正在附加GIF -
我有一个博客博客,我已经成功将域名设置为我的网站的子域名,例如http://blog.jthink.net
但是我如何实际将博客嵌入到我的网站上,以便它与我的主网站(http://www.jthink.net)具有相同的页眉和页脚,所以它更像是他们在这里做的方式
甚至可以与博主一起使用?
我试图设置gulp-inject来将依赖项注入index.html.除了转换功能外,一切正常.我需要以下列方式替换部分文件路径:/frontend/src/- > /static/我尝试这样做(从某处复制粘贴):
transform : function ( filePath, file, i, length ) {
                var newPath = filePath.replace('/frontend/src', '');
                console.log('inject script = '+ newPath);
                return '<script src="/static/' + newPath  + '"></script>';
            }
Run Code Online (Sandbox Code Playgroud)
执行后,我在控制台中没有任何内容(标准gulp输出除外),并且未转换的文件路径出现在结果文件中.看起来我的自定义转换不会运行,而默认转换工作正常.
我在我的Android应用程序中使用blogger api通过使用REST API将博客内容与它集成,作为json的对象.
我需要按标签检索/过滤帖子.在大多数博客中,博客标签的链接通常是
https://abtallaldigital.blogspot.com/search/label/Food
https://abtallaldigital.blogspot.com/search/label/Technology
Run Code Online (Sandbox Code Playgroud)
我阅读了所有api文档,我看到它与博客,帖子,评论,页面,用户有关,但是没有办法处理标签/类别.
应用程序中有一个类BloggerAPI,用于检索博客
package abtallaldigital.blogspot.com.dummyapp;
import retrofit2.Call;
import retrofit2.Retrofit;
import retrofit2.converter.gson.GsonConverterFactory;
import retrofit2.http.GET;
import retrofit2.http.Url;
public class BloggerAPI {
    public static final String BASE_URL =
            "https://www.googleapis.com/blogger/v3/blogs/2399953/posts/";
    public static final String KEY = "THE-KEY";
    public static PostService postService = null;
    public static PostService getService() {
        if (postService == null) {
            Retrofit retrofit = new Retrofit.Builder()
                    .baseUrl(BASE_URL)
                    .addConverterFactory(GsonConverterFactory.create())
                    .build();
            postService = retrofit.create(PostService.class);
        }
        return postService;
    }
    public interface PostService {
        @GET
        Call<PostList> getPostList(@Url String url); …Run Code Online (Sandbox Code Playgroud) blogger ×2
android ×1
angularjs ×1
css ×1
css-filters ×1
grunt-usemin ×1
gruntjs ×1
gulp ×1
gulp-inject ×1
html ×1
java ×1
javascript ×1
jquery ×1
json ×1
minify ×1